description European grapevine moth Overview
European grapevine moth, Lobesia botrana, is a tortrix moth and an agricultural pest of grapevines and other berry crops. Its larvae feed on grape flowers and berries, often tying plant tissue with silk; feeding wounds can also make fruit more vulnerable to bunch rot caused by Botrytis. The species is native to Europe and has spread to other wine-growing regions, so vineyards and plant-health agencies monitor it through trapping, inspection and controls on infested fruit or plant material. It can reduce the quality and yield of wine and table grapes.
